The Minnesota DNR has found that many veterans covet a job in a natural resources environment because many military skills are a great fit for DNR positions.  With that in mind, they will be hosting an employee seminar for military veterans.

The free seminar is scheduled for January 3 at the DNR headquarters on Lafayette Road North in St. Paul.  Space is limited so registration is required.

According to the DNR, veterans in attendance will have the opportunity to talk to DNR staff who work in the areas of logistics, fisheries and wildlife, informational technology, GIS and mapping, forestry, operations, communications, safety, real estate forestry, enforcement, human resources, engineering and landscape architecture and more.

Veterans will also be on hand to answer questions about how to successfully juggle military – civilian commitments. Information on DNR veteran support resources will also be available.

Taking it a step further, there will also be human resources staff on hand to provide instructions on how to search and apply for Minnesota DNR jobs.
